Whitacre steals the show
The world premiere of The Stolen Child by Eric Whitacre proved to be one the highlights of the National Youth Choir of Great Britain’s 25th anniversary gala concert on 13 April.

The piece, a setting of WB Yeats, was composed for The King’s Singers (who were marking their 40th anniversary) and National Youth Choir, and was conducted by Whitacre in front of a capacity audience at Symphony Hall, Birmingham.
